KAPA‘A — There were no grab-and-go meals at the public schools Friday because of the Good Friday holiday.
Instead, Leong’s Meat House in Kapa‘a offered free chili bowls to children all day during its open hours of 10 a.m. to 5 p.m.
“There is no grab-and-go today,” said Kristen Leong of the Leong’s Meat House. “We raise our own beef, and this was a good way for us to give back to the community.”
A steady stream of hungry patrons waited patiently in the rapidly-mounting morning heat, some overflowing to check out the offerings of the Aloha Lani Farms tent laden with fresh vegetables.
“I didn’t even know about this,” said Lee Anne Nago, who waited with her friend and a brood of keiki. “My brother-in-law shops here, and he told us about it. This is good. We could even walk over.”
Leong, working with a crew jamming to prepare chili bowls, said this was not the first time Leong’s Meat House has hosted a giveaway.
“Last time, we did a poke-bowl giveaway,” Leong said. “That was pretty successful with about 150 bowls being distributed. This time, since we raise our own beef, we thought we would do chili bowls for the keiki. It’s just a small way for us to give back.”
